  • Samurai pruning saw

    I have personally tried out this saw, on on a rather large tree branch to see how it would cope the branch was about 7 to 8 inches across. And I treated the branch as I would if using a chainsaw but I only used the samurai except for it taking longer to cut no fault to the saw. it done an excellent job very controlled and it dropped the branch exactly where i intended. You would not use this saw in the way that I have described above, you could but not sure how long it would last if you did. it would be perfectly suited to cutting 1-inch to 2 1/2 inches very easily and quickly. The curved blade makes it easy to cut on the pull action and gets to cut a part of the other side. Ideal for trimming and pruning small trained trees and bushes where a power tool is not needed. After I did cut that big branch off I I then cut the rest of it up into pieces using my much loved husqvarna as I had to much big stuff to do and I didn't want to be there for weeks on end lol. If you've only got one tree looking for a light trim this is one cracking handsaw. It comes any hard plastic outer case with a quick release clip attachment so if it's around your belt the outer case can be removed with the saw inside. If I ever need to get another one I wouldn't hesitate too. But mine will be for use while in a tree on small branches.

  • Excellent product

    This is an excellent quality saw. The curved blade cuts through branches easily with its tempered / hardened teeth. It cuts on the 'pull' stroke (as opposed to the more familiar 'push' stroke) but this is not an issue because the effort required is minimal because of the saw's sharpness. The handle is very comfortable to grip and the sheath / belt clip is very useful when up a ladder and you need two hands free. I looked at less expensive straight-bladed saws and also those that cut on both strokes, but decided this was worth the extra cost without having to buy a Silky. I'm expecting this to last a very long time.
